1. Thassos: Full-Day Cruise with BBQ and Swim Stops

At number one, this full-day cruise promises a comprehensive and tasty way to experience Thasos. For around $51 per person, you’ll set sail with a local captain who shares stories about the island’s history and legends. The tour includes swimming and snorkeling at some of Thasos’ most beautiful spots—think crystal-clear waters perfect for floating around in. The highlight is the Greek BBQ lunch, which features grilled meats, fresh salads, and bread, complemented by a glass of local wine.
Guests consistently rate this experience 4 out of 5 stars based on 65 reviews, praising its friendly atmosphere and scenic stops. The boat is comfortable, music is lively, and the relaxed pace makes it ideal for families or anyone wanting a full day of fun on the sea. The landscape views from the water are truly stunning, with cliffs and green hills framing the coast. Plus, the captain’s storytelling adds a personal touch that makes the experience memorable.
Bottom Line: This cruise offers excellent value for a full day of swimming, local food, and scenic sailing, making it perfect for those who want a lively, all-inclusive experience with authentic Greek flavors.
2. Thassos Island: Sailing Day Cruise Beer & Snack

At number two, the Thassos Sailing Day Cruise Beer & Snack is a shorter, 5-hour journey that’s perfect if you’re pressed for time but still want a taste of the sea. For about $73 per person, you’ll cruise on a 40-44 ft sailboat with a local skipper who knows the waters intimately. The tour highlights include sailing past Thasos’ most unique shores and stopping at beaches and coves that are perfect for swimming and relaxing.
This tour stands out because of its relaxed pace and focus on enjoying refreshing drinks and tasty snacks. The crew serves a new sandwich—which is quite popular—alongside a glass of wine or beer, making it a laid-back way to unwind. The reviews mention the scenic beauty from the water as a major plus, with many noting how picture-perfect the coastline looks from the deck. It’s well-suited for those wanting a more intimate, less crowded experience on a smaller boat.
Bottom Line: For travelers seeking a shorter, stylish cruise with a focus on scenic views and casual fun, this tour offers great value and a chance to capture stunning photos of Thasos from the water.
